Output 93b86a17a00941c47c22dba928068ef2a10807208555d3cc93d85988ae947a9d:2

value
50633883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ed5a2339f9b1b559268f9c28df49ca162debe73 OP_EQUAL
address
MGYbfz5qpjaqdvVq8PgpxKyysBBHYmerL5
transaction
93b86a17a00941c47c22dba928068ef2a10807208555d3cc93d85988ae947a9d
spent
true